No and Yes: They have what they have; they cannot create new germs from nothing. So, no, they won't obtain new STD-type germs. However, they can transfer "germs" from one area to another, and create an STD by using the germs they already have. For example, if one has oral herpes (non-STD), she can transfer her herpes to his penis via sucking on his penis, thus creating an STD. Don't stick things into anuses.
